Understanding the Landscape of Medical Device Exports

Medical devices encompass a wide array of products, from surgical instruments to diagnostic equipment. The export of these products is not only vital for business growth but also plays a crucial role in improving healthcare worldwide.

According to recent market research, the global medical devices market is projected to reach over $600 billion by 2025, driven by technological advancements and increasing healthcare expenditure. For B2B suppliers, understanding this landscape is essential for identifying target markets and aligning products with regulatory requirements.

Key Factors Influencing the Export Market

Several factors contribute to the success of medical device exports:

  • Regulatory Compliance: Each country has its own regulations governing medical devices. Suppliers must familiarize themselves with these requirements to ensure compliance and facilitate smoother entry into new markets.
  • Market Demand: Assessing the local demand for specific medical devices is crucial. Conducting market research can help suppliers identify trending products and areas for expansion.
  • Distribution Channels: Establishing effective distribution networks is vital for timely delivery and maintaining competitive pricing.

Strategies for Successful Medical Device Exports

To effectively navigate the medical device export landscape, suppliers should consider the following strategies:

1. Leverage Digital Platforms

The digital landscape has transformed how businesses operate, making it easier for suppliers to connect with potential buyers worldwide. Establishing a robust online presence through a dedicated website, social media, and online marketplaces can enhance visibility and reach.

2. Build Strong Relationships

Networking is crucial in the B2B sector. Attend industry trade shows, conferences, and exhibitions to connect with key stakeholders, including healthcare providers, distributors, and regulatory bodies. Building lasting relationships can lead to lucrative partnerships and repeat business.

3. Focus on Quality and Innovation

In the medical device industry, quality is paramount. Suppliers must prioritize the manufacturing of high-quality products that meet international standards. Additionally, investing in research and development can lead to innovative solutions that set a supplier apart from competitors.

4. Understand Cultural Differences

When exporting to different regions, it’s essential to understand cultural nuances that may affect business dealings. Tailoring marketing strategies and communication styles to suit local customs can enhance customer relationships and facilitate smoother transactions.

The Role of Technology in Medical Device Exports

Technology plays a crucial role in streamlining the export process. From supply chain management software to advanced analytics, embracing technology can ensure efficiency and reduce costs. Moreover, automation in production can help suppliers scale operations to meet global demand.
